    Magu lists seven demands from Salami-led Presidential panel

    The lawyer to the suspended acting Chairman of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Mr. Ibrahim Magu, on Friday reportedly pleaded with the Presidential Investigation Committee to grant him bail.

    He said Magu needed the bail because the print and electronic media had taken undue advantage of his detention to launch a campaign of calumny against him.

    He made six other demands including making the terms of reference of the committee available to Magu and giving him the opportunity to know the allegations against him.

    1) That our client will appreciate if afforded the privilege of the terms of reference of this distinguished Committee.

    2) That the petitions containing the allegations be given to our client to afford him the opportunity of knowing the allegations against him, study same, and prepare a robust defence.

    3) That our client will appreciate the intervention of the Committee in ordering the release of our client from custody to enable him defend himself adequately and attend to his deteriorating health in custody.

    4) That our client be given adequate time to respond to the allegations against him including providing necessary materials and evidence before this Honourable Committee.

    5) That our client be afforded the opportunity to confront the petitioners with his own defence.

    6) That witnesses be examined in his presence and that of his counsel.

    7) That our client be guaranteed his right to fair hearing including his right to liberty in the course of the proceedings of this distinguished Committee.
